About the Journal
Acta Psychedelica is a peer-reviewed, diamond model open-access interdisciplinary journal accepting submissions on scientific research on psychedelic substances and experiences from all perspectives and fields of study, including (but not limited to): psychology, medicine, neuroscience, pharmacology, philosophy, anthropology, sociology, theology, and history. The journal is committed to advancing scientific literature on the effects of psychedelic substances as well as their broader societal and ethical implications. The journal welcomes both empirical work and theoretical discussions, and is particularly receptive to research that is critical, crosses disciplinary boundaries, and addresses neglected or controversial issues.
We accept Research articles, Book reviews and Essays and commentaries in English, Finnish, and Swedish.
This new non-profit journal is published by the Finnish Association for Psychedelic Research, run by researchers in the field, and aims to foster rigorous and open scientific discourse on psychedelics.
